> Your Europe - contribute to the diversity consultation
> From now until 16 May you can rewrite how Europe should tackle
> cultural diversity. Help shape the future by going online and
> responding to a paper produced by the 'Rainbow Platform' - Civil
> Society Platform for Intercultural Dialogue, an initiative of the ECF
> and Culture Action Europe (EFAH) - facilitated by LabforCulture.

> This paper brings many issues of intercultural dialogue to the fore.
> Should there be a system of monitoring and reporting on the practice
> of intercultural dialogue, and if so, who should do this? Is it right
> that the EU should 'mainstream' diversity policies in its various
> programmes? Can there be an agreed 'European standard' for supporting
> culture?
>
> The set of recommendations is very much a work-in-progress. Your
> constructive feedback is absolutely vital. The results will be
> discussed at a plenary meeting of the Rainbow Platform in Brussels on
> June 4th 2008 - the same date on which the Platform becomes an
> officially recognised discussion partner with the EU institutions.
>
> The Rainbow Paper process started in January 2008 at the launch of
> the European Year of Intercultural Dialogue and the start of the
> Slovenian EU Presidency. LabforCulture is committed to facilitating
> public participation and knowledge exchange and to linking the
> cultural sector to European-wide cross-sectoral issues.
>
> Let the platform know your thoughts. The Platform intends to present
> a set of standard-setting recommendations at the European Year of
> Intercultural Dialogue 2008 closing colloquium.
